What services are typically offered at memory care facilities in Kenmore, New York?

Memory care facilities in Kenmore, New York, typically offer a wide range of specialized services tailored to individuals with Alzheimer's disease, dementia, and other cognitive impairments. These services may include 24/7 supervision and care by trained professionals, personalized care plans, and assistance with activities of daily living (ADLs) such as bathing, dressing, and grooming. Additionally, memory care facilities may often provide secure environments to prevent wandering, cognitive therapies to slow the progression of memory loss, medication management, and structured activities designed to promote cognitive function and social engagement. Facilities may also offer amenities such as nutritious meals, housekeeping, laundry services, transportation, and access to on-site medical care or physical therapy.

How do memory care facilities ensure the safety of their residents?

Memory care facilities often implement several safety measures to protect their residents. These may include secured entryways and exits to prevent residents from wandering off, which is a common concern in individuals with dementia. Many facilities are designed with a layout that minimizes confusion and reduces the risk of falls, such as circular hallways and open common areas. Additionally, residents are often equipped with wearable devices that allow staff to monitor their location and wellbeing. Emergency response systems should be in place, with staff trained to handle crises such as medical emergencies or behavioral issues promptly. Regular safety drills and staff training sessions should further ensure that all team members are prepared to provide a secure environment for residents.

What should families consider when choosing a memory care facility in Kenmore, New York?

When choosing a memory care facility in Kenmore, New York, families should consider several important factors to ensure they select the best environment for their loved one. First, it's crucial to evaluate the facility's staff-to-resident ratio, as this can impact the level of personalized care and attention each resident receives. The qualifications and training of the staff, particularly in dementia care, should also be assessed. Families should visit the facility to observe the cleanliness, atmosphere, and overall environment, paying close attention to how residents interact with staff and each other. It's also essential to review the range of services and activities offered, ensuring they align with the specific needs and interests of the individual. Additionally, consider the facility's policies on medical care, including how they manage health issues and emergencies. Finally, cost is an important factor, so families should understand the pricing structure and what services are included or available at an additional cost. Reading reviews and asking for references can also provide valuable insights into the facility's reputation and quality of care.

Are there any specialized memory care programs available in Kenmore, New York, that focus on specific stages of dementia?

Some memory care facilities in Kenmore, New York may offer specialized programs tailored to specific stages of dementia. These programs are designed to meet the unique needs of individuals at different levels of cognitive decline, providing appropriate care and activities that cater to their current abilities. Early-stage programs often focus on maintaining cognitive function and independence through activities that stimulate the brain, such as memory exercises, puzzles, and social engagement. As dementia progresses, mid-stage programs may emphasize structured routines, physical activities, and emotional support to help residents navigate daily challenges. For those in the later stages of dementia, memory care facilities may offer more intensive care with a focus on comfort, safety, and quality of life, including sensory stimulation therapies and personalized care plans. Families should inquire about the specific programs offered at each facility and how they adapt to the changing needs of residents as their condition evolves.
